What Is Battery Storage for Factories?

Battery storage systems store electrical energy for later use. The stored electricity can come from several sources, including:

Solar photovoltaic systems
Off peak grid electricity
Wind energy systems
Other renewable energy technologies

The battery system can then discharge electricity when demand increases, energy prices rise or renewable generation falls.

This allows factories to become more flexible and efficient in managing their energy requirements.

The Key Benefits of Battery Storage for Factories

Lower Electricity Costs

One of the primary reasons manufacturers invest in battery storage is to reduce energy expenditure.

Electricity prices often fluctuate throughout the day. By charging batteries during lower cost periods and using stored energy during peak rate periods, factories can significantly reduce their electricity bills.

This strategy helps businesses avoid purchasing expensive electricity during periods of high demand.

Peak Demand Management

Many commercial electricity contracts include charges based on peak power usage.

Short periods of high energy demand can increase overall electricity costs substantially.

Battery storage systems can discharge energy during these peak periods, reducing demand from the grid and helping factories minimise costly demand charges.

Better Use of Renewable Energy

Many factories are investing in solar PV systems to reduce energy costs and carbon emissions.

However, solar generation does not always align with production schedules.

Without battery storage, excess solar energy generated during daylight hours may be exported back to the grid rather than used on site.

Battery storage captures surplus solar generation and stores it for later use, allowing businesses to maximise the value of their renewable energy investment.

Is Battery Storage Suitable for Every Factory?

Battery storage can deliver benefits across a wide range of manufacturing sectors.

Industries that often see strong returns include:

Food and beverage manufacturing
Engineering facilities
Automotive production
Packaging manufacturers
Warehousing and distribution centres
Cold storage facilities
Pharmaceutical production
Agricultural processing plants

However, every site is unique.

Factors such as energy consumption patterns, operational hours, available renewable generation and electricity tariff structures all influence system design.

This is why a detailed site assessment is essential before selecting a battery storage solution.
